The surname Sosa is a common surname found in various countries around the world. It is believed to have originated in Spain, specifically in the region of Galicia. The name is derived from the Galician word "sousa," which means "forest" or "woodland." This suggests that the original bearers of the surname may have lived near or worked in a forested area.
Over time, the surname Sosa spread to other Spanish-speaking countries such as Mexico, Argentina, and Venezuela, as well as to countries in Central and South America. It is also found in the United States and other parts of the world, although in smaller numbers.
According to data collected from various countries, the surname Sosa is most prevalent in Argentina, with over 216,000 individuals carrying the name. This is followed closely by Mexico, where there are approximately 157,000 people with the surname Sosa. In Paraguay, the name is also quite common, with over 50,000 individuals bearing the surname.
In the United States, the surname Sosa is less common, with around 45,000 individuals with the name. However, it is still a significant presence in the country, especially in states with large Hispanic populations such as Texas and California. In Venezuela, Peru, and Cuba, the surname Sosa is also fairly common, with thousands of individuals carrying the name in each country.

Throughout history, there have been several notable individuals with the surname Sosa who have made significant contributions in various fields. One such individual is Sammy Sosa, a former professional baseball player from the Dominican Republic. Sosa is best known for his time with the Chicago Cubs, where he was a prolific home run hitter and fan favorite.
Another famous individual with the surname Sosa is Mercedes Sosa, a renowned Argentine singer and songwriter. Sosa was known for her powerful voice and passionate performances, which often featured songs that addressed social and political issues in Latin America.
